Gazpacho Smoothie with Wild Garlic

Gazpacho Smoothie with Wild Garlic is a refreshing drink or light meal of raw blended vegetables. Perfect on a hot day, substitute a small clove of garlic & greens like spinach when wild garlic isn't in season.

Ingredients

  • 150 g cucumber (about a third of a whole one) roughly chopped
  • 80 g tomatoes (about 10 cherry tomatoes) roughly chopped
  • Half medium red pepper roughly chopped
  • Half small red onion roughly chopped
  • 1 large handful wild garlic roughly chopped (see Recipe Notes for alternatives)
  • 2 tbsp olive oil
  • 1-2 tbsp red wine vinegar or sherry vinegar
  • salt to taste
  • black pepper to taste
  • 1 pinch dried chilli flakes (optional)
  • ice cubes
  • celery sticks to serve (optional)

Instructions

  1. Put all the vegetables, the wild garlic and the olive oil in a blender, food processor or a suitable container if using a stick blender.

  2. Add 1 tablespoon of the vinegar, a little salt and pepper plus the chilli flakes if using and 10-12 ice cubes.

    Blend until just combined, taste and add more vinegar or seasoning if necessary.

  3. Blend again until smooth (add more ice if you like) then divide between 2 glasses and serve with an optional celery stick.

Recipe Notes

If you don't have wild garlic: add one small clove of finely chopped garlic plus a handful of greens such as spinach or lettuce.
